Mo1171 A META-ANALYSIS OF ENDOSCOPIC RESECTION FOR SUBMUCSOAL ESOPHAGEAL ADENOCARCINOMA
Abstract
Esophagectomy is the standard care for submucosal esophageal adenocarcinoma (SMC). However many patients with SMC also have severe medical co-morbidities precluding them from surgery, leaving a minimally invasive alternative to be desired. Some reports have supported the use of endoscopic resection (ER) for SMC that are limited to the superficial third of the submucosa (<500um) and have absent lymphovascular invasion and poor differentiation....
